Incase you didn't watch the dev commentary...


Yes, the escape to freddy's 2 will not only be real, but we plan to turn the escape to freddy's itself into an entire SERIES of games! 4 to be exact, each one corresponding to the 4 games of TRTF volume 1.

However, we need some time, first. The escape to freddy's 2 won't simply be a remake of trtf2, or a gamified version of trtf2's post-night cutscenes. Much like the wario's series, we want each game to try something unique with its gameplay, while still remaining fun, and in ETF2's case, we need to do quite a bit of planning before it can even get a gamepage. This is because A) We want to learn gamemaker for the rest of the ETF series, and B) We wanna try making a few other games first so we don't get tired of working on this series.

All that said, though; We all hope you look forward to what we have in store. We promise you all that this will be the most bizarre re-telling of the TRTF saga, and that it'll be kinda fun too. Thank you all for your support, and have a great day!
